Alcaeus

English dictionary entry

Meanings

name
  1. A name of Greek origin, particularly borne by an Ancient Greek lyric poet of Mytilene (c. 620–6th century BCE).

Word forms

Alcaeus Alkaios Alcæus

Etymology

Borrowed from Latin Alcaeus, from Ancient Greek Ἀλκαῖος (Alkaîos).
